Find Japanese Restaurants
Near: Bigler
- Wallaceton Japanese Restaurants
- Woodland Japanese Restaurants
- West Decatur Japanese Restaurants
- Mineral Springs Japanese Restaurants
- Morrisdale Japanese Restaurants
- Allport Japanese Restaurants
- Kylertown Japanese Restaurants
- Hawk Run Japanese Restaurants
- Osceola Mills Japanese Restaurants
- Munson Japanese Restaurants